Recommended Vaccinations for India

While there are no mandatory vaccinations for entry into India, some are highly recommended to protect yourself from potential health risks. “India’s tropical climate and unique environmental factors mean certain diseases might be more prevalent than what you’re used to back home,” advises Dr. Anya Sharma, author of “The Healthy Traveler’s Guide to Southeast Asia.”

Here’s a breakdown of recommended vaccinations:

  • Routine Vaccinations: Ensure your routine vaccinations are up-to-date, including those for measles, mumps, rubella (MMR), diphtheria, tetanus, pertussis (DTaP), polio, and influenza.
  • Hepatitis A and B: These viral infections are common in India and can spread through contaminated food and water. Vaccination provides the best protection.
  • Typhoid: Another food and water-borne illness, typhoid is prevalent in developing countries.
  • Cholera: While less common, cholera outbreaks can occur. Consider this vaccination, especially if you’re traveling to remote areas or during the monsoon season.
  • Japanese Encephalitis: If you plan on spending significant time in rural areas, particularly during the rainy season, talk to your doctor about the Japanese encephalitis vaccine.

Additional Considerations

Beyond these, your specific vaccination needs might vary based on your itinerary, length of stay, and personal health. For instance, if you plan to trek through the Himalayas, rabies vaccination might be advisable. “Always consult with a travel health specialist at least 4-6 weeks before your trip,” recommends Dr. Sharma. They can provide personalized advice based on your unique travel plans.

Planning Your Trip to India

Preparing for a trip to India involves more than just vaccinations. Here are some additional tips to ensure a safe and enjoyable journey:

Visa Requirements

Most foreign nationals require a visa to enter India. You can apply for a tourist visa online through the e-Visa system or at your nearest Indian embassy or consulate.

Currency Exchange

The Indian currency is the Indian Rupee (INR). Exchange currency at banks, authorized money changers, or upon arrival at the airport.

Transportation

India has a vast network of trains, buses, and flights connecting major cities and towns. Within cities, auto-rickshaws and taxis are readily available.

Accommodation

From budget-friendly guesthouses to luxury hotels, India offers a wide range of accommodation options to suit every budget and preference.
